Since the 13th of January there is a new VBox version 6.1.2 available and announced in VBox Manager like:


You can download it and install, but installing the 6.1.2. Extension Pack gives troubles.
Installing procedure is endless. So stay to 6.1.0 (or older) as long as that is not solved.

There are a couple of suggestions in their Forum but none worked for me, or for others it seems. Even uninstalling 6.1.0 to install 6.1.2 didn't allow the Extension Pack to upgrade.
I only have 2 Windows hosts. Both have been left at 6.1.2 with the 6.1.0 Extension Pack (not recommended but no issues so far)
It is probably better to stick with 6.1.0 with the 6.1.0 Extensions until the upgrade issue is resolved in case there are incompatibility issues when not using the VBox and Extensions of the same version number but I couldn't be bothered downgrading both machines to the previous version again.

Version 6.1.2 with VirtualBox Extension Pack installed OK now.

I tested this version on Windows with a running Theory- and ATLAS-task including several suspends (LAIM off), resumes, Theory snapshots, BOINC-restart and BOINC start after reboot. All without issues.

I am not so lucky. I repeatedly encounter stuck Atlas tasks that go overtime without ever completing or crashing. Some VMs are completely unresponsive, but most are still active and show a kworker issue. All tasks have in common that their log shows a "timesync vgsvcTimeSyncWorker: Radical guest time change" error. They all have been previously suspended for various reasons, so my assumption is that resuming doesn't work any more reliable than with previous VBox versions.

Therefore resuming should still be avoided, if at all possible. (BOINC 7.12.1 and VBox 6.1.2)

Edit: VBox is also littered with several inactive (crashed and completed) VMs.
